Output 93bc79f37308fbcacbd1a78dde65f88d28aaa1b2bb353633ad7492850190de55:0

value
662250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75fcaa633c7221e6442e688e5c63e147e6855821 OP_EQUAL
address
3CSsfVx6Ne86L7yGSzwaHuH3UJPZ6XmcpP
transaction
93bc79f37308fbcacbd1a78dde65f88d28aaa1b2bb353633ad7492850190de55
spent
true